About Us
Our community originated in 1978 as a covenant community called “Community of God’s People.” Members of three prayer groups, two from the Gulf Coast and one from South Dakota, came together to make the first covenant. For a number of years we were in a teaching relationship with the People of Praise in South Bend, Indiana. Members of that community made regular visits and provided guidance to us. On Feb 7, 1987, we dissolved our covenant and 14 members signed the covenant of People of Praise while 21 others became underway members, and we became the Biloxi Branch of the People of Praise.
We presently consist of 21 members, 16 adults and five children (One family of five on assignment with the Air Force). We meet weekly in members’ homes for a branch gathering and in men’s and women’s groups. We also gather frequently for various social events. Blessed with close proximity to other branches of the People of Praise, we have contact several times during the year for men’s and women’s retreats, kids summer camp, picnics, and other gatherings. We have hosted numerous visitors from other branches in recent years and welcome visitors in the future.
